Responsibilities:

1. Overseeing and managing all aspects of the manufacturing process, ensuring efficiency and quality are maintained at all times.
2. Utilizing your expertise in solid modeling to design and optimize manufacturing processes.
3. Implementing and monitoring process improvements for the production of plastic and rubber products.
4. Working closely with the production team to troubleshoot and resolve issues related to rubber molding and injection molding processes.
5. Conducting detailed process analysis to identify areas for improvement and develop innovative solutions to enhance productivity and quality.
6. Collaborating with cross-functional teams to ensure that all processes are aligned with the company's strategic objectives.
7. Providing technical guidance and training to junior engineers and other team members.
8. Complying with all safety and environmental regulations and maintaining up-to-date knowledge of industry trends and advancements.

Qualifications:

1. A Bachelor's Degree in Engineering or a related field.
2. A minimum of 2 years of experience in process engineering, preferably within the rubbers or plastics manufacturing industry.
3. Proven experience with compression and/or injection molding.
4. Extensive knowledge of plastic and rubber products manufacturing processes.
5.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to identify and implement process improvements.
6. Excellent communication and leadership skills, with the ability to guide and mentor junior team members.
7. A keen eye for detail and a commitment to quality.
8. Proficiency with computer software related to process engineering and solid modeling.
9. A proactive approach, with the 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
